Native New Yorker Laura Warfield writes (and co-writes) the songs that range from folk/rock to country/ blues, pop and children''s music as the spirit moves her. Her topics are wide ranging, from love rejected ("Leave Your Love Behind") to love renewed ("Get Closer"), from what passes for the economy ("Unemployment Line") to women''s issues ("Lord Have Mercy"), from the pitfalls of seeking for the truth ("Turn Around, Spin Around") to those of overcoming prejudice ("Live In My World") and the possibilities of bringing peace to the world "New Millenium." The songs with more than a touch of rueful humor, along with memorable melody, rhythm and rhyme, run through their repertoire. As Laura says in "Turn Around, Spin Around" "You panhandle smiles till after a while you even beguile yourself.".
